Editing on Vista
Hey, I'm going to be purchasing a new laptop near the end of the summer holidays, and I was just wondering if I'd still be able to edit on Adobe Premiere 6.5 and Adobe After Effects 6.5 Pro? If Premiere wouldn't work, would I have to buy a copy like Premiere Pro 2?

Re: Editing on Vista
According to Adobe, the only programs they CLAIM to be Vista compatible are the new CS3 series. From what I've searched on the web, I've heard that Premiere 6.5 - 2.0 likely won't work. I just got some information saying that premiere 6.5 might run if you set it to windows xp compatability mode in vista.
